MongoDB Overview

  • What it is: MongoDB is a popular NoSQL document database. This means it stores data in flexible, JSON-like documents, rather than traditional rows and columns found in relational databases (like MySQL or PostgreSQL).

  • Key Features:

    • Document-Oriented: Data is stored in documents, making it easier to represent complex data structures.
    • Scalability: Designed for horizontal scaling, allowing you to add more servers to handle increased workloads.
    • Flexibility: No rigid schema requirements, allowing for easy adaptation to changing data needs.
    • High Performance: Indexing, aggregation framework, and other features contribute to fast query performance.
    • Replication: Built-in replication for high availability and data redundancy.
    • Sharding: Distributes data across multiple servers (shards) for improved scalability.
    • Aggregation Framework: Powerful tool for data transformation and analysis.
    • MongoDB Atlas: MongoDB s fully managed cloud database service.
    • ACID Transactions: Supports ACID transactions for multi-document operations, ensuring data consistency.
    • Security: Robust security features including authentication, authorization, and encryption.
  • Use Cases:

    • Content Management Systems (CMS)
    • E-commerce platforms
    • Mobile applications
    • Internet of Things (IoT)
    • Gaming
    • Analytics and Big Data
    • Personalization

Revenue

  • MongoDB is a publicly traded company (ticker: MDB).

  • Revenue Model: Primarily based on subscriptions to MongoDB Atlas (their cloud service) and enterprise software licenses, as well as professional services and training.

  • Recent Revenue Figures:

    • 2024 (Fiscal Year): $1.68 billion, an increase of 22% year-over-year.
    • Q1 2025: $450 Million, an increase of 22% year-over-year.
  • Key Revenue Drivers: MongoDB Atlas is the primary growth driver. New customer acquisition, expansion of existing customer usage, and adoption of advanced features all contribute to revenue growth.

Alternatives to MongoDB

Here s a breakdown of popular alternatives, categorized by type:

  • Other NoSQL Databases:

    • Cassandra: Highly scalable, distributed NoSQL database designed for high availability. Good for write-heavy workloads.
    • Couchbase: Document database with a built-in caching layer for fast performance.
    • DynamoDB (Amazon Web Services): Fully managed NoSQL database from AWS. Highly scalable and reliable.
    • Cosmos DB (Microsoft Azure): Globally distributed, multi-model database service from Azure. Supports multiple NoSQL APIs (including MongoDB API).
    • Redis: In-memory data store often used for caching, session management, and real-time analytics. (Key-value store)
    • Neo4j: Graph database optimized for relationships between data points. Great for social networks, recommendation engines, and knowledge graphs.
  • Relational Databases (SQL):

    • PostgreSQL: Open-source relational database known for its extensibility and standards compliance.
    • MySQL: Widely used open-source relational database.
    • Microsoft SQL Server: Relational database from Microsoft, offering a range of features and editions.
    • Oracle Database: Powerful and feature-rich relational database commonly used in enterprise environments.
  • Considerations When Choosing Alternatives:

    • Data Model: Does your data fit a document model, key-value store, graph, or relational model best?
    • Scalability Requirements: How much data will you be storing, and how many requests will you need to handle?
    • Performance Needs: What are your latency requirements?
    • Availability: What level of uptime do you need?
    • Features: Do you need specific features like ACID transactions, full-text search, or geospatial indexing?
    • Cloud vs. On-Premise: Do you want a fully managed cloud service, or are you managing your own infrastructure?
    • Cost: Compare pricing models carefully.

Pricing

MongoDB offers various pricing options:

  • MongoDB Atlas (Cloud Service):

    • Free Tier: Limited usage for small projects and experimentation.
    • Shared Tier: For smaller workloads with shared resources. (e.g., M0, M2, M5 clusters)
    • Dedicated Tier: For production workloads with dedicated resources (e.g., M10, M20, M30, etc.). Pricing scales based on instance size, storage, network usage, and features.
    • Serverless: Pay-as-you-go with on-demand scaling.
    • Data Lake: Pay for query usage and storage.
  • MongoDB Enterprise Advanced (Self-Managed):

    • Requires a commercial license.
    • Pricing is typically based on the number of cores or servers used.
  • Factors Affecting Cost:

    • Instance Size/Type: Larger instances cost more.
    • Storage: The amount of storage you use.
    • Network Bandwidth: Data transfer costs.
    • Backup and Recovery: Backup frequency and retention policies impact costs.
    • Support Level: Higher levels of support come at a premium.
    • Features: Advanced features like encryption at rest or auditing may have additional costs.
  • Key Considerations for Pricing:

    • Estimate Your Resource Needs: Carefully estimate your CPU, memory, storage, and network requirements.
    • Monitor Usage: Track your resource consumption to optimize costs.
    • Reserved Instances/Committed Use Discounts: Consider these options for long-term cost savings.
    • Data Transfer Costs: Be mindful of data transfer costs, especially if you re moving data between regions or cloud providers.
    • Evaluate Different Tiers: Compare the features and costs of different tiers to find the best fit for your needs.

Customer Care Details

MongoDB offers a range of customer support options:

  • Documentation: Extensive online documentation covering all aspects of MongoDB.

  • Community Forums: Active community forums where users can ask questions and share knowledge.

  • MongoDB University: Free online courses and tutorials to learn MongoDB.

  • Support Portal: For paid support customers, a support portal to submit tickets and track progress.

  • Support Plans (for MongoDB Atlas and Enterprise Advanced):

    • Developer Support: Basic support for development environments.
    • Standard Support: For production environments, offering faster response times and 24/7 availability for critical issues.
    • Premier Support: The highest level of support, including dedicated support engineers and proactive monitoring.
  • Contacting Support:

    • Online Support Portal: The primary method for paid support customers.
    • Phone Support: Available for certain support plans, especially for critical issues.
  • Key Considerations for Customer Care:

    • Severity Levels: Understand the severity levels used by MongoDB support (e.g., Critical, High, Medium, Low).
    • Response Times: Know the expected response times for your support plan.
    • Escalation Process: Understand how to escalate issues if needed.
    • Support Hours: Be aware of the support hours available for your plan.
    • Prepare Information: When contacting support, be ready to provide detailed information about your issue, including error messages, logs, and steps to reproduce the problem.
